The Amazon Kindle Paperwhite Wi-Fi allows you to read in the dark. If you like to read before bed, you will love the Kindle Amazon Paperwhite WiFi 6in. It is the best Kindle to date and offers more features than you could ever imagine. The best part is that it is lightweight.


With a new design, you will love the feel of the Amazon Kindle Paperwhite. It is similar to the Kindle Touch. The modern design and generous bezel are much like those of the last Kindle. This Kindle is black and looks great.


The Amazon Kindle Paperwhite features a front-lit display. It is easy to read, no matter what time of the day. Whether reading in bed or at the beach, the Paperwhite provides a superior reading experience.


This e-reader looks great and has a soft touch to provide a finger-friendly feel. It weighs about 200g. It is similar to the Kindle Touch in weight. However, it offers more features, which makes it worth the extra effort to carry it around.


The Kindle Amazon Paperwhite WiFi 6in does not have a navigation button. It has a power button on the bottom, which is next to the microUSB charging socket. You will love the fact that it is straightforward and easy to use. The Kindle Amazon Paperwhite WiFi offers an improved user experience and was designed with readers in mind. There is a lot to love, which makes it an excellent buy.


There are no page turn buttons and no home button. Everything is done using the touchscreen. The touchscreen is responsive. The Kindle Paperwhite is perfect, no matter your interest. Plus, you can use it anywhere.


Amazon has made some changes in regards to hardware. The best part is that there is no headphone jack. Plus there is no internal speaker.


The Kindle Amazon Paperwhite WiFi 6in has a lot to offer. Amazon has made Cloud stored books easy to access. This means that you do not need a lot of on-device storage. Get your Kindle Amazon Paperwhite WiFi 6 inch and take advantage of all that it has to offer.

Amazon Kindle Paperwhite (2013) Review

The new Amazon Kindle Paperwhite improves upon last year's model but doesn't break what worked. Sporting a high-quality display, even light, comfortable design, and speedy performance, it's a good value at $120.
Pros:
  • Comfortable design
  • Excellent display and reading light
  • Great software offerings and book extras
  • Speedy performance
Cons:
  • Base price includes advertising
  • No microSD card slot
  • DRM and file format restrictions lock you to Amazon
